What Are Backlinks?



Backlinks are links from other websites that link to your site. They are a crucial factor in determining the rank of a website as they show that other websites consider your site's value and worth linking to. In other words, backlinks are a vote of confidence from other websites which tell Google, "This website is worthy of being ranked higher."

The type of link matters too.



Backlinks are one of the most crucial factors Google utilizes to determine a website's rank. The more backlinks you can get from top-quality websites more highly your website will appear in results of a search.



However it is true that not all backlinks are all created equal. There are many factors Google takes into account in determining the value of a backlink, including:




  • The page where the backlink is located


  • The anchor text in the link


  • Its domain authority is that of the linked website


  • The importance of linking to the website


  • The age of the backlink


  • There are many backlinks that are from the same website



All of these factors influence the quality of an backlink's quality. When you're trying to increase the number of backlinks you have it is important to concentrate on getting quality backlinks from trustworthy websites.

Buying links



Back in the early days of the internet, it was very easy to cheat the system using purchasing links. You could simply pay a few dollars be able to have your website listed on thousands of low-quality websites.



However Google's algorithms have advanced quite a ways since then and are now able to identify purchased links. Not only will this get your site penalized, but it can also damage your reputation. Today, the best method to convince people to share your site is to create quality content that they will be eager to share. If you focus on producing useful, informative, and entertaining content, you will be able to earn links naturally and avoid any sanctions from Google.

Backlink terms that you need to know



Now that we've covered what backlinks are and why they're important we'll take a look at some of the terms you must know.



Nofollow links



A nofollow hyperlink is a link which doesn't transmit all the juice of a link. In other words it does nothing to improve your website's SEO.



Links that are not followed can be beneficial, however. They can help increase your site's visibility and increase traffic to it. They can also help build connections with other websites in your field.



If you're building backlinksfor your website, you should avoid links that are nofollow whenever you can. But, you don't have to stress about these links excessively. There are a few links that don't follow and there won't hurt the SEO of your site.



DoFollow hyperlinks



If you're trying to boost the SEO of your website, you should consider dofollow hyperlinks. Dofollow links are the type of links that pass along link juice, which helps improve your website's visibility in the search results pages. By building backlinks from high-quality sites, it is possible to increase the amount of dofollow links linking to your site and boost the amount of traffic you receive.



Be aware, however, that every link is not created in the same way. Make sure you concentrate on building links from reputable websites that are relevant to your particular niche. Doing so will give you the best chance of success in achieving higher search engine rankings and increasing web traffic.



Anchor text



When you're building backlinks anchor text is an important consideration. The anchor text will be the text that is used in a link. It's it's the clickable portion of the link that will take you to another page. Using keyword-rich anchor text will help boost your site's position in search results for these keywords.



For example, if you own a website about gardening, you'll want to use the phrase "gardening suggestions" as your anchor text when creating backlinks. This can help increase your website's ranking for that search term.



The creation of backlinks using keywords-rich anchor text is an essential website aspect of SEO, and it will help increase the overall rank of your website in search engines.

PageRank (PR)



PageRank is an indicator created by Google. It's similar to domain authority however, it's unique to Google. PageRank is determined by the number and quality of hyperlinks that point towards a website. The higher a website's PageRank is, higher the likelihood it is to rank well in the search results pages.



The acquisition of backlinks from sites with high PageRanks is always a great idea at any time. A high PageRank indicates that a website is well-known and reliable, two qualities that are sure to please Google. Additionally, websites with high PageRanks tend to have high-quality content, another element that Google will consider when evaluating pages. By building backlinks from high PageRank websites increases your odds of getting a better position on SERPs.



Link juice



Link juice is the term used to describe the SEO value that's passed along via a hyperlink. This is the factor that improves your site's rank on search results pages. The more link juice a site has, the more valuable it is for building backlinks. That's why it is important to seek out hyperlinks from websites that have excellent domain authority and PageRanks.



Link juice can be considered a form of currency that's transferred between websites. When one website links with another one, they're essentially transferring some of the link juice on to the other website. This can improve the second website's ranking in search engine results pages and increase its authority and visibility. In order to get the most value of link juice you need to build links from high-quality websites. This will ensure that you're receiving the most valuable link juice possible.

Reciprocal linking



Reciprocal linking is the act of exchanging links with a different website. In the sense that they link back to your site while they hyperlink to your site. Reciprocal linking was a popular way to build backlinks. However, it's no longer as effective as it once was. In addition, it could hurt your website's SEO. This is why you should stay clear of any reciprocal linking at all costs.



There are many reasons for why reciprocal linking isn't more effective. First, Google as well as other engines have become more adept at identifying fake link-building. As a result, they have begun to penalize websites who are involved in this type of practice. The second reason is that the majority of users have caught on to the fact reciprocal linking isn't useful. A lot of websites have decided not to do it that it's becoming ineffective as a method to build links. In addition, reciprocal linking could actually hurt your SEO if you're not careful. If you link to a poor quality website, it may impact your ranking. In all of these instances it is best to stay clear of reciprocal linking altogether.



Link farms



Link farms are generally composed of low-quality websites that exist for the sole reason to increase the number of links that are popular. Unfortunately, search engines have caught the ploy and now penalize websites that take part in link farming. As a result, it is best to avoid link farms completely. If you are unsure whether a website belongs to a link farm, you can verify the link profile of the site using a tool like ahrefs. If the vast majority of the site's links are from other websites that are part of the same network then it is likely a link farm.
